Greek politician. Born in Crete. Participated in the anti-Turkish War of Independence, and became Minister of Justice of the Cretan Autonomous Government in 1899. Invited to Greece in 1909 as a leader of the constitutional reform movement, he served as Prime Minister five times between 1910 and 1933, participated in World War I, and promoted Greater Hellenicism, including the abolition of the monarchy and the establishment of a republic.
